Finally, microcontrolller Ethernet on the cheap that is easy to use.

The EDTP Packet Whacker is a 10Base-T Ethernet microcontroller NIC that allows you to add Ethernet functionality to your favorite AVR microcontroller.

The Packet Whacker is based on the industry standard NE2000-compatible Realtek RTL8019AS Ethernet IC. All pins of the RTL8019AS that are used to implement Ethernet connectivity with an AVR microcontroller are brought out to standard .100 inch center holes on the Packet Whacker's printed circuit board. Example ImageCraft C-based source code, onboard status LEDs, A 20MHz crystal and consolidated magnetics and RJ-45 interface in the form of an LF1S022 make the Packet Whacker very easy to deploy in your AVR Ethernet-based application.

The idea is to provide low-cost easy to implement Ethernet for AVRs. Using the resources of the EDTP Electronics web site, you can find everything you want (or need) to know about the RTL8091AS in the form of free documentation, source code, schematics and data sheets.

Packet Whacker sells for $25 in kit form and $35 fully assembled and ready to go.
